We are a leading provider of public transport in the UK bus and rail service sectors, delivering over one billion passenger journeys each year. Almost two million journeys per day take place on our bus network – as well as being London’s largest bus operator, we own eight regional UK bus companies. Currently a FTSE250 company employing 29,000 people across the country, we’re also expanding our international bus and rail portfolio.
We are strong believers in local brands run by local management for local markets, and so are looking for motivated graduates who will grow and develop into our future engineering managers and directors.
Go-Ahead’s two-year graduate engineering programme develops people to become a key part of the engineering management function, and is IMechE accredited, suited to graduates aspiring to gain Incorporated or Chartered status. Our engineering graduates are fast-tracked through an introduction to maintenance workshops and practices, exposed to vehicle design and production, and gain knowledge of emerging technologies. This is all alongside developing the key competencies that should be expected of any great graduate scheme: finances, HR, health & safety, and communication.
Our engineering grads can expect to be exposed to:
- Workshop environments – think vehicle inspections, identifying defects, accident repairs etc
- MOT preparation and testing
- Responsibilities around Quality and Technical Engineering requirements
- Fleet maintenance
- Document and operational management
Go-Ahead are looking for Engineers with a hands-on, practical approach to complement their degree-level education. Applicants should have:
- Minimum of a 2:2 in mechanical or electrical / electronic engineering
- An interest in tinkering with engines and understanding how they work. If you’re the kind of person who likes to take things apart, see how they run and put them back together again, this role will suit you nicely!
- Experience using the Microsoft Office suite
- The unrestricted right to work in the UK on a permanent basis
